Flying Scotsman – Food & Drink Event – Full Steam ahead

The Flying Scotsman visited the Scottish Borders on Sunday 15th May. To celebrate there was a  Food and Drink Fayre with a marquee housing a range of fantastic local Scottish Borders Food and Drink producers & providers including: Tweedbank’s own Tempest Brewing Co. to The Chainbridge Honey Farm, Border Tablet, Thomas & Ethel,  Macamoon,  Cuddybridge Apple Juice, Stichill Jerseys  and soon to be starting up as craft brewers- Stow Brewery were there for people to sample their wares and learn more about their plans for the site by the new Waverley line station in Stow , and much more…

Thousands of people came along to sample and buy some lovely produce from the Borders. In addition to the farmers market there was a variety of local catering options including: Gary Moore Catering, The Juicy Meat Co. and a licenced bar by Tempest Brewing Co. There was live music, and other great stalls such as Main Street Trading Company selling Books and Deli items from their shop, Borders Book Festival to  Locus Focus who have created and ‘Borders Railway Guide’ which was also available on the day to buy too.. It really was a fantastic day and the ideal place to celebrate this landmark day and visit from the legendary Flying Scotsman!
